We are less than a month away from the Spring season and one local nonprofit organization is gearing up for a fun event in the Canyon and Amarillo community. The Randall County Sheriff’s Posse will host their annual barrel race for a full day on Saturday April 13th at the RCSP Arena located at 8500 W. Cemetery Road.

Expos will happen at 10AM, 10:30 AM, 11AM, 11:30 AM and noon and each one has a cost of $5 to participate in the activity each lasting a maximum of 30 minutes with a limit of five tickets per person. The race will cost $20 for youth attendees 12 and under with 5D open costing $50 per ticket. There will be an office fee of $10 to get in for purchases made at the venue itself before the race begins at 1PM and competitors see who is the fastest in the game to create the winning record.

Pre-entrance will be available until 5PM on Thursday April 11th so be sure to get in contact with Katelyn at 505-660-8658 or Sara at 817-454-8964. One open ride night will be offered the night before from 6:30 to 8:30 PM costing 10/rider.
